Abstract
The beam propagation method (BPM) was used to study a 4/spl times/4 active switch with electro-optical effects in a titanium diffused lithium niobate (LiNbO/sub 3/:Ti) based directional coupler, and the results were used to develop the design. This design is capable of de-multiplexing wavelengths from two groups, 1100 nm to 1300 nm and 1500 nm to 1600 nm.
